The Role of Preventative Medicine Programs in Animal Welfare and Wellbeing in Zoological Institutions

Paolo Martelli, Karthiyani Krishnasamy

Published in 2023

Scientific review highlighting the fact that the usual animal welfare paradigms do not apply to animals in zoos, particularly when the animals are undergoing veterinary treatment. In such circumstances, the animals' physiology and behavior are deregulated, and freedom of choice and comfort are limited. The authors propose that a distinction should be made between the state of well-being experienced by the animal (well-being) and the societal management of animal welfare (welfare), and to base the wefare management of zoo and aquarium animals on preventive medicine.

Final Report of an Audit of Croatia carried out from 2 May to 14 October 2022 in order to Evaluate Animal Welfare Controls During Transport by Livestock Vessel to non-EU Countries

DG SANTE

Published in 2023

Audit report identifying weaknesses in the current system to control the protection of animals transported by sea from Croatia to third countries, including the absence of documented procedures to for the authorization of transporters by sea and the failure of inspectors to identify certain deficiencies. It contains three recommendations to the competent authorities to improve the effectiveness of the official system for the protection of animal welfare during sea transport.

Impact of palmiped farm density on the resilience of the poultry sector to highly pathogenic avian influenza H5N8 in France

Billy Bauzile, Benoit Durand, Sébastien Lambert, Séverine Rautureau, Lisa Fourtune, Claire Guinat, Alessio Andronico, Simon Cauchemez, Mathilde C. Paul, Timothée Vergne

Published in 2023

Scientific article on the development of a model of the 2016-2017 avian influenza epidemic to show that even a slight reduction in the density of palmiped farms in the most densely populated areas would have considerably reduced the number of poultry farms affected. However, this measure would not have been sufficient to completely prevent the spread of the virus.
